What is Cloud Traffic Mirroring?
Cloud Traffic Mirroring A cloud-native capability that duplicates network traffic to analysis tools for monitoring, threat detection, and compliance without impacting production systems.

How is “Cloud Traffic Mirroring” Used in Practice?
Enable cloud traffic mirroring on critical subnets so SOC tools can analyze all east-west and north-south flows for threats and anomalies.
